Miss Grand International 2020 contestants visit Wat Phra Kaew (Temple of the Emerald Buddha)


Miss Grand International 2020 pre-pageant activities continue with today's visit to the beautiful Wat Phra Kaew (Temple of the Emerald Buddha).

Wat Phra Kaew is regarded as the most sacred Buddhist temple in Thailand. The complex consists of a number of buildings within the precincts of the Grand Palace in the historical center of Bangkok. It houses the statue of the Emerald Buddha, which is venerated as the country's palladium.

The contestants looked stunning in their traditional Thai costumes as they were photographed at the temple with the reigning Miss Grand International Valentina Figuera of Venezuela.

Standouts were beauties from the Czech Republic, Spain, Argentina, Vietnam, Indonesia, Mexico, Russia, Peru, the Philippines, and Puerto Rico.
